Managing AWS CloudTrail costs effectively requires understanding the pricing structure and identifying areas for cost reduction.
Duplicated trails in AWS CloudTrail can lead to increased costs as multiple copies of events incur charges.
To avoid unnecessary expenses, consider keeping organization trails and using IAM roles for access control instead of creating duplicate trails.
Data events in CloudTrail also contribute to costs, with charges from the first copy onwards.
Filtering out less critical logs for data events can help reduce costs and manage expenses more efficiently.
Monitoring CloudTrail costs using tools like Cost Explorer provides visibility into PaidEventsRecorded and DataEventsRecorded metrics.
Regular monitoring of expenses can help track CloudTrail spending and ensure compliance without overspending.
Understanding the serverless nature of AWS CloudTrail is essential for cost control, as it automatically records API activity without the need for server management.
By comprehending how AWS charges for CloudTrail services, misconfigurations can be avoided, maintaining compliance at a lower cost.
AWS CloudTrail offers value for auditing, security monitoring, and operational troubleshooting but can become expensive due to tracking all activities and generating audit logs.